3. Sheriff Country

What it’s about: Sheriff Country is a CBS Original drama (and Fire Country spinoff) that follows the straight-shooting sheriff Mickey Fox (Morena Baccarin) as she patrols the streets of her hometown Edgewater. She balances her demanding work life with her complicated family life, as her ex-con father (W. Earl Brown) moves in with her after a mysterious incident with her wayward daughter Skye (Amanda Arcuri).
Why you’ll love it: Sheriff Country is a hit law enforcement drama that brings fans a new case every episode that pushes the cast of characters as they work together to take down the criminals and keep their hometown safe. It also brings a complex family dynamic that fans of the Dutton family know all too well.

4. Landman

What it’s about: Landman is a Paramount+ original from co-creators Taylor Sheridan and Christian Wallace. It is a modern-day tale of fortune seeking set in West Texas, where oil rigs rule. Tommy Norris (played by Oscar® winner Billy Bob Thornton) is the lead character and landman of an oil company. The show focuses on the roughnecks and wildcat billionaires trying to get rich quickly in the oil business. The show also stars Oscar® nominee Demi Moore, Oscar® nominee Andy Garcia, Ali Larter and Oscar® nominee Sam Elliott.
Why you’ll love it: Landman is a top-notch drama that will keep you guessing from episode to episode with an all-star cast and jaw-dropping story. The show is fueled by character-driven drama and family conflict just like your beloved Marshals. Join the millions of viewers and get addicted to this hit show.

5. Fire Country

What it’s about: Fire Country is a CBS Original drama that stars Max Thieriot as Bode Leone, a young convict who gets a second chance at life when he joins a prison-release firefighting program in Northern California. Things get complicated for Bode when he gets assigned to the program in his hometown of Edgewater.
Why you’ll love it: Fire Country is an action drama that shows how a team works together to keep people safe in the town where they’ve always lived. Bode Leone is a complicated man whose past makes it hard for him to pursue new beginnings, very similar to Kayce’s new life as he joins an elite unit of the U.S. Marshals.
